Why You Need to Hire a Bookkeeper:

1. Accuracy:

Bookkeepers are the unsung heroes of a business's financial operations, wielding their expertise to maintain the accuracy and integrity of financial records. Trained professionals with a keen eye for detail, they meticulously record every transaction, from invoicing clients to tracking expenses and reconciling accounts. Their specialized knowledge of accounting principles and software tools enables them to navigate complex financial landscapes with ease, ensuring that no detail goes unnoticed.

By diligently cross-referencing data, double-checking entries, and adhering to best practices, bookkeepers minimize the risk of errors and discrepancies in your financial records. This dedication to accuracy not only instills confidence in the reliability of your financial data but also lays a solid foundation for informed decision-making and strategic planning. In a world where precision is paramount, a skilled bookkeeper is an invaluable asset, safeguarding the financial health and stability of your business.

3. Compliance

Navigating the intricate landscape of tax laws and financial regulations is no small feat, especially when these regulations are subject to frequent updates and revisions. Fortunately, a seasoned bookkeeper serves as a vigilant guardian, staying abreast of the latest developments and ensuring that your business remains in strict compliance. With their expertise and attention to detail, they meticulously track changes in tax codes, reporting requirements, and industry-specific regulations, sparing you the headache of deciphering complex legal jargon. By proactively adapting your financial practices to align with current regulations, a bookkeeper not only mitigates the risk of costly fines or penalties but also fosters a culture of transparency and accountability within your organization.

Their commitment to compliance not only protects your bottom line but also upholds the integrity and reputation of your business in the eyes of stakeholders and regulatory authorities alike. In essence, entrusting your compliance efforts to a knowledgeable bookkeeper provides invaluable peace of mind, allowing you to focus on driving your business forward with confidence and clarity.

5. Cost-effectiveness

While the initial expense of hiring a bookkeeper may give pause to some business owners, the long-term benefits far exceed the upfront costs. By enlisting the expertise of a skilled professional, businesses can avoid costly mistakes that could otherwise result in financial setbacks or legal ramifications. Moreover, a bookkeeper's adeptness at maximizing tax deductions and ensuring compliance can lead to significant savings come tax time, effectively offsetting their service fees. Beyond tax savings, their diligent financial management can uncover inefficiencies, streamline processes, and identify opportunities for cost reduction, ultimately bolstering the bottom line. In essence, while the investment in a bookkeeper may seem daunting at first, the return on investment manifests in the form of improved financial health, enhanced profitability, and sustainable growth for the business in the long run.

By viewing hiring a bookkeeper as a strategic investment rather than a mere expense, businesses can reap the rewards of sound financial stewardship and position themselves for long-term success.
